Biography of Jan Lisiecki
Jan Lisiecki was born on March 28, 1995, in Calgary, Alberta, Canada, to Polish parents. From a young age, he displayed an extraordinary aptitude for music, beginning his piano lessons at the age of five. His prodigious talent quickly became evident, and he was soon performing in public recitals. By the age of nine, Lisiecki had already gained recognition as a child prodigy, captivating audiences with his technical mastery and emotional expressiveness.

Early Years and Musical Beginnings
Jan Lisiecki's early years were marked by a deep immersion in music. His parents, both avid music lovers, played a crucial role in nurturing his talent. They introduced him to a wide range of classical compositions, fostering his appreciation for the works of composers like Chopin, Mozart, and Beethoven. By the age of seven, Lisiecki was already studying under renowned piano instructors, honing his skills and developing his unique style.
First Lessons and Influences
Lisiecki's first piano lessons were with local teachers in Calgary, but it wasn't long before his exceptional talent caught the attention of prominent music educators. At the age of nine, he began studying with renowned pianist and teacher, Kum-Sing Lee, at the Vancouver Academy of Music. This marked a turning point in his musical journey, as he was exposed to advanced techniques and a deeper understanding of classical repertoire.
Early Performances
Even as a child, Lisiecki's performances were met with enthusiasm and acclaim. His debut public recital at the age of nine showcased his remarkable ability to interpret complex compositions with maturity and sensitivity. By the time he was a teenager, he had already performed with several orchestras, including the Calgary Philharmonic Orchestra and the Vancouver Symphony Orchestra.

Career Milestones and Achievements
Jan Lisiecki's career is marked by numerous milestones that highlight his exceptional talent and dedication to music. One of his earliest significant achievements was signing with Deutsche Grammophon, one of the most prestigious classical music record labels, at the age of 15. This partnership launched his international career and provided him with the platform to reach a global audience.
Debut Albums and Critical Acclaim
Lisiecki's debut album, "Chopin: Études," released in 2013, received widespread critical acclaim. Critics praised his interpretation of Chopin's works, noting his ability to blend technical precision with emotional depth. This album not only solidified his reputation as a rising star in the classical music world but also earned him several awards and nominations.

Notable Recordings and Collaborations
Over the years, Jan Lisiecki has released several critically acclaimed albums, each showcasing his versatility and depth as a musician. His recordings have earned him numerous awards and nominations, further solidifying his status as one of the leading pianists of his generation.
Top Albums
- Chopin: Études (2013): Lisiecki's debut album, which received widespread critical acclaim for its technical precision and emotional depth.
- Mendelssohn: Piano Concertos Nos. 1 & 2 (2015): A collaboration with the Orpheus Chamber Orchestra, showcasing Lisiecki's ability to interpret Mendelssohn's works with sensitivity and nuance.
- Schumann: Works for Piano and Orchestra (2017): A critically acclaimed album featuring Lisiecki's interpretations of Schumann's piano concertos.

Awards and Recognition
Jan Lisiecki's contributions to classical music have been recognized with numerous awards and accolades. His performances and recordings have earned him praise from critics and audiences alike, solidifying his reputation as one of the most talented pianists of his generation.
Notable Awards
- Gramophone Award: Lisiecki received the Gramophone Award for Young Artist of the Year in 2013, recognizing his outstanding contributions to classical music.
- ECHO Klassik Award: He has won multiple ECHO Klassik Awards, including the Solo Recording of the Year award for his album "Mendelssohn: Piano Concertos Nos. 1 & 2."
- Opus Klassik Award: Lisiecki was honored with the Opus Klassik Award for Instrumentalist of the Year in 2019, further cementing his status as a leading figure in classical music.
